Dear Blair Academy Administration,

It has been brought to my attention by many of our prefectees and sophomore friends are unable to attend prom this spring if asked. This new rule not only affects the sophomores but the upperclassmen as well. I am sure you are all aware that in high school, students have relationships. These relationships are essential to growth and are normal. However, what is not normal or typical in any other high school is discriminating against couples who happen to be grades apart.

After discussing the reasoning for this new rule with Mr. Facc, I understand your reasoning for not allowing sophomores to go to prom. Though the feelings of others who may not be asked this year are important, it is also a part of life. Their time will come and I think the majority would agree. Prom is a part of high school and a huge deal for a senior. Prom is two days before graduation and not allowing someone to bring their long term girlfriend is frankly, wrong. In a place with so many rules, there should be at least the freedom to bring who you want to prom. After all, Blair teaches students about commitment so why not follow through regarding committed relationships?


I hope you will think about this and reconsider this rule regarding prom.
